UNIX Operations Engineer
PlayFirst is a leading publisher focused on creating shared casual game experiences around lasting original brands. Committed to building casual gameplay rich in story and character, PlayFirst works with talented internal and external developers to bring mass market games to multiple platforms, including PC, Mac, mobile, handheld and console. The company's portfolio includes the world-renowned Diner Dash® franchise as well as top-selling games such as Wedding Dash, Chocolatier, and Dream Chronicles. Job Description:
PlayFirst is looking for a Senior Systems Administrator to support and expand the network operations of the PlayFirst.com web site and corporate computing infrastructure. The Senior Systems Administrator will manage remote and local Ubuntu Linux servers from installation through repurposing, including application deployment, monitoring and troubleshooting. They will support individual development environments and shared Quality Assurance, Staging and Production environments. They will manage network access rules on an ad hoc and systematic basis. They will also work with the Site Production team, the Site Development team and the Site QA team to balance the required tasks.
